Tribune News Service

Mussoorie, April 20

Workers of the Nehru Institute of Mountaineering (NIM) have begun work on a three-tier protection wall, along with the construction of ghats at Kedarnath prior to the opening of the shrine portals on May 9.

Additional Commissioner, Garhwal, Harak Singh Rawat visited the shrine and reviewed the construction work. He lauded the efforts of the NIM team and directed them to be prepared to greet pilgrims on the opening day of the yatra.

The NIM officials said the works were going on at war footing and would be complete by May 9.
